Thermo Scientific™ Titan3™ Nylon (Polyamide) patented Syringe Filters provide cleaner sample extracts by removing interfering materials and fine particles.
Hydrophilic nylon is extremely well suited for aqueous or organic sample preparation and HPLC, GC or dissolution sample analysis. Due to its excellent flow characteristics and mechanical stability, nylon offers the best combination of physical parameters to meet the most stringent analytical needs.
Low extractable membranes and housings ensure that no filter-borne contaminants are added to your sample. Performance-tested under actual HPLC conditions. Integral 1 mm borosilicate glass pre-filter (30 mm devices) ensures greater confidence with high solids samples. Reinforcing ring provides greater strength to the housing to prevent leakage and bursting (maximum pressure for 30 mm devices 15 bar / 210 psi). Housings are manufactured from solvent-resistant, low-extractable polypropylene resins specifically selected for wide compatibility with common HPLC sample matrices. Able to filter solutions at temperatures up to 100 °C.
Color coding makes it easy to select the correct membrane and pore size. Packed in re-usable rigid transparent color-coded containers. Syringe filters can be sterilized by autoclave at 125 °C for 15 minutes. Enhanced Luer lock inlet prevents leakage; outlet fitting is a standard size male Luer-slip fitting for ease of filtrate collection.
